摘要
盛大金磐2号楼通过调整房型和墙体布置,在层3设置转换大梁实现了荷载的竖向传递。采用加大端部横墙及其附近混凝土构件的截面面积和提高端部柱的抗震等级的方法减小了结构扭转效应。计算结果表明,通过提高结构的整体性和对构件的合理设计,结构整体变形、周期比、位移比均满足规范要求。
The transmission of vertical loads in a super high-rise building is achieved by adjusting the arragement of shear wall and setting large transfer beams at the No.3 floor.The torsion effect is diminished by enlarging the section of head wall and its vicinal concrete members and enhancing the seismic grade of the end columns.The calculation results show that under the condition of good structural integrity and rational design of members;the structural integer deformation meets the requirement of the code;the structural period ratio and displacement ratio are acceptable.
